A solution containing Mg 2+ and Ta 5+ was added to an aqueous ammonia solution of oxine, resulting in a precipitate. After the precipitate was thermally decomposed and fired, it was mixed with BaCO 3 powder and fired again at high temperatures to obtain Ba(Mg 1/3 Ta 2/3 )O 3 (BMT). This method resulted in BMT formation at temperatures lower than those used in the conventional mixed‐oxide method, and single‐phase BMT formed directly at 1300°C without intermediates.
